Chemical compound

Uranium monophosphide is acompound ofuranium andphosphorus, synthesized from heating metal uranium and white phosphorus:

4 U + P4 → 4 UP

It is a potentialnuclear fuel.

In air, a thinglassy surface layerprotects the compound from oxidation; over the course of months after synthesis, this layer develops a metallic sheen.
